Machine Safety Switches –
Easy Access
The wiring chamber is accessed via a hinged door. Simply insert a flat-blade screwdriver,
as shown, and pry gently down to open.
Rotating Actuator Head
The actuator head may be rotated in 90° increments to create eight possible actuator
engagement locations. To rotate the head, pull the holding clamp forward, rotate the
head to the desired position, and push the holding clamp back in to lock.
All mounting hardware is supplied by the user. Fasteners must be of sufficient
strength to guard against breakage. Use of permanent fasteners or locking hardware
is recommended to prevent loosening or displacement of the actuator and the switch
body. The mounting holes in the switch body and the actuator accept M5 screws (see
dimensions, page 7).
Position the switch, with its actuator fully engaged, in the mounting location and mark the
mounting holes. Drill the required holes and fasten the switch body and the actuator in
place. After the mounting hardware is secure, check the actuator-switch engagement for
misalignment and binding.
